A loss to UNC will likely mean an unhappy season.

Expectations for this team are probably unrealistically high, as most are recalling only the UT and Clemson games and not the 9 games prior. Lest we forget, after 9 games, this fan base was in the depths of despair, having been inexplicably owned at home by Mizzou and then absolutely whipped at UF.

A LOT remains to be seen about this team, Rattler in particular. Will we get Rattler from Games 1-9 or Rattler from Games 10-11? Will we be able to run the ball...at all? Will we be able to get any pressure on the opposing offense? Does Dowell Loggains know what he's doing?

A loss to UNC will bring back all the dark thoughts in a hurry.

This team has some questions to answer on both sides of the ball. The O-Line wasn't great at protecting Rattler, we don't have a real running back like a MarShawn Lloyd. On the defensive side, we gave up 30 or more points the last three games of the season and we lose Cam Smith to the draft.

If we can't be at least be competent running the ball, we'll be in trouble. We were 102nd nationally last year and next to last in the SEC in rushing yards per game (though Mississippi State was last, they were also dead last in the nation in rushing attempts/game).

It's hard to make the RB position look good. Juju is our leading returning rusher at 219 yards. God bless Dakereon for coming back and trying a new position but other teams won't be worried about our rushing attack. Maybe Mario Anderson or the Freshman Dontavius Braswell can give us some touches.
